修改自選股
POST/v1/quote/modify-user-security修改用戶自選股:把標的加入某分組、僅從某分組移出、或從所有分組徹底刪除。查詢自選分組用 user-security-group;查詢分組下自選用 user-security。
請求參數
| 參數 | 類型 | 位置 | 必填 | 說明 |
|---|---|---|---|---|
group_name | string | 請求體 | 否 | 自選分組名(同名取首個),最長 100 字符;僅支持自定義分組。op=ADD/MOVE_OUT 必填;op=DEL 可不填。 |
op | string | 請求體 | 是 | 操作類型:ADD=加入指定分組 / DEL=從所有分組徹底刪除 / MOVE_OUT=僅從指定分組移出。 |
code_list | string[] | 請求體 | 是 | 股票代碼列表,必須非空,單次 1-200 個。例:["HK.00700","US.AAPL"]。 |
X-Futu-Client-Nnid | string | 請求頭 | 是 | 用戶身份(牛牛號)。 |
請求示例
bash
curl -X POST "$ip/v1/quote/modify-user-security" \
-H "Content-Type: application/json" \
-H "X-Futu-Client-Nnid: 99034182" \
-d '{"group_name":"我的自选","op":"ADD","code_list":["HK.00700","US.AAPL"]}' | jq響應字段
| 字段 | 類型 | 說明 |
|---|---|---|
result_code | int | 操作結果碼,成功恆為 0。 |
限制範圍
- 市場:支持全部市場(HK / US / CN / SG / JP / 加密貨幣等),凡能解析出證券的合法代碼均可。
- 品類:支持正股 / ETF / 窩輪 / 期權 / 期貨 / 指數 / 債券等全部品類。
- 分組:ADD / MOVE_OUT 針對單個自定義分組(一次一個 group_name);系統預置分組不作為操作目標。DEL 不依賴分組,從所有分組移除。
code_list單次最多 200 個。
錯誤碼
| ret_code | error.code | 觸發條件 | 處理建議 |
|---|---|---|---|
| -3 | invalid_parameter | 缺 op / op 非法 / code_list 為空或 >200 / group_name >100 字符 / op=ADD|MOVE_OUT 缺 group_name / 分組不存在 / 代碼格式錯誤。 | 校正請求參數後重試。 |
| -7 | invalid_symbol | code_list 中代碼格式合法但查無此證券。 | 通過 search 確認代碼合法性。 |
| -8 | unsupported | 對系統 / 虛擬分組做非法增刪。 | 改用自定義分組。 |
| -9 | permission_denied | 缺 X-Futu-Client-Nnid 身份 / 身份無效。 | 補充用戶身份後重試。 |
| -5 | internal_error | 網關或後端內部錯誤。 | 稍後重試,持續失敗聯繫支持。 |
響應示例
json
{
"ret_code": 0,
"ret_msg": "success",
"data": {
"result_code": 0
}
}